EV> Could XP see a 3TB HDD or is 2TB the limit as You wrote earlier. EV> Thanks, 73 de Ed W9ODR You'd likely be able to read one 2tb partition on the drive under XP if the sata controller itself supports drives over 2tb (if not it just won't show up at all), but to partition anything over 2tb on a drive you need to use GPT instead of MBR formatting, and the earliest OS that will read a GPT/GUID drive is Vista on the consumer side, and Server 2008 on the Enterprise side.
